Pacimol Drops is a trusted prescription medicine formulated to relieve pain and reduce fever in children. It is commonly used for conditions such as headaches, toothaches, body aches, and fever, providing safe and effective relief when administered as directed. Designed for oral use, Pacimol Drops is best given after food to minimize stomach irritation and should be administered at a consistent time each day for optimal results. The exact dosage is determined by your child’s age, weight, and the severity of their symptoms, so it is important to follow your pediatrician’s instructions carefully.

How It Works
Pacimol Drops combines analgesic and antipyretic properties to manage pain and fever. It blocks specific chemical messengers in the brain responsible for signaling pain and increasing body temperature. This dual mechanism ensures that your child feels more comfortable and recovers faster from common ailments.
How to Use
Measure the prescribed dose using a dosing cup and administer orally. Shake the bottle well before use. Pacimol Drops may be given with or without food, but consistency in timing is recommended for best results. Avoid giving other medications containing paracetamol simultaneously to prevent overdose.
Safety Information
-
Kidney & Liver: Use with caution in children with kidney or liver issues; consult your doctor for dose adjustments. Avoid in severe liver disease.
-
Common Side Effects: Temporary effects such as stomach pain, indigestion, nausea, or vomiting may occur; consult your doctor if persistent.
-
Other Precautions: Inform your doctor if your child has blood disorders, allergies, or congenital conditions before starting treatment.
-
Missed Dose: Administer the missed dose as soon as possible unless it is near the next scheduled dose. Do not double doses; follow the regular schedule.
